This post introduces strategies for achieving data efficiency by "shifting left" data governance and processing. It highlights the importance of schemas for data consistency and quality, and the potential of stream processing (using Apache Flink) for efficient data transformation. It also emphasizes the role of open table formats like Apache Iceberg for data reusability and consistency. Three key strategies are presented: implementing no-copy and zero ETL solutions, shifting data governance left, and reducing data waste by processing data at the source.
